Batteries are a crucial component of electric vehicles (EVs), yet they are extremely sensitive to heavy mechanical loads (e.g. crash). For a flexible and affordable crash absorber that helps batteries withstand collisions, automotive OEMs, designers, and engineers can turn to our polycarbonate blend.
By absorbing kinetic energy in the side sills, which are located below the wheel arches and protect the vehicle's body from side hits, a crash absorber keeps the EV battery safe.

A cutting-edge, multi-material housing for an electric vehicle battery has been introduced by Continental Structural Plastics of Auburn Hills. The item can be produced using any of Continental's unique composite formulations as well as honeycomb Class A panel technology created at the business's new Advanced Technologies Center.
The full-sized battery enclosure is a multi-material component with a one-piece composite lid and one-piece composite tray with reinforcing made of aluminium and steel. CSP claims it has developed a solution that is simpler to seal and can be approved prior to shipment by moulding the cover and the tray into each of one piece. For its unique box assembly and fastening technologies, the company has filed for two patents.
Additionally, the business created a mounting structure that absorbs energy using structural foam. In addition to enhancing crash performance, this allows for a thinner and lighter structure.
In order to give their clients additional alternatives for current and upcoming vehicle programs, they are developing technologies and procedures here that make use of CSP and Teijin's expertise in carbon fibre, manufacturing, thermoplastic and thermoset composites, and thermoset composites. They can lighten things up while enhancing occupant safety and durability, two essential qualities for connected, driverless, and electric vehicles.
According to the business, a steel battery box weighs 15% more than the CSP battery enclosure. Even though it weighs the same as an aluminium enclosure, the CSP enclosure has better temperature resistance than aluminium, particularly if a phenolic resin system is employed.
Additionally, the tray's one-piece design means that there are no through holes, therefore sealing or sealant is not necessary. This lowers production costs and complexity overall while also eliminating the possibility of leakage.
